本文目录导读:
随着大数据技术的不断发展,视频数据在各个领域中的应用越来越广泛,Hudi(Hadoop Upsert Distributed Dataset)作为一种基于Hadoop的分布式数据湖存储系统,具有高性能、高可用性、可扩展性等优点,本文将介绍如何利用Hudi数据湖存储视频,为用户提供高效、稳定、便捷的视频数据管理解决方案。
Hudi数据湖简介
Hudi是一种基于Hadoop的分布式数据湖存储系统,具有以下特点:
图片来源于网络,如有侵权联系删除
1、高性能:Hudi支持多种存储引擎,如HDFS、Alluxio、Amazon S3等,能够满足不同场景下的存储需求。
2、高可用性:Hudi采用分布式存储架构,能够保证数据的高可用性。
3、可扩展性:Hudi支持水平扩展,能够根据实际需求动态调整存储资源。
4、灵活性:Hudi支持多种数据模型,如Copy-on-Write、Merge-on-Read等,能够满足不同场景下的数据管理需求。
5、易用性:Hudi提供丰富的API和工具,方便用户进行数据管理。
Hudi数据湖存储视频方案
1、视频数据格式
在存储视频之前,需要确定视频数据格式,常见的视频格式包括MP4、AVI、MKV等,为了保证视频数据的兼容性和存储效率,建议选择MP4格式。
2、视频数据预处理
在存储视频之前,需要对视频数据进行预处理,包括:
(1)视频转码:将视频转换为MP4格式,确保视频格式兼容性。
图片来源于网络,如有侵权联系删除
(2)视频剪辑:根据实际需求,对视频进行剪辑,提高视频存储效率。
(3)视频元数据提取:提取视频的元数据信息,如视频时长、分辨率、帧率等,便于后续管理和检索。
3、Hudi数据湖存储架构
(1)HDFS存储:将预处理后的视频数据存储在HDFS上。
(2)Hudi数据存储:在HDFS上创建Hudi数据存储,用于存储视频数据。
(3)Hudi表:创建Hudi表,用于管理视频数据。
4、Hudi数据湖存储流程
(1)数据上传:将预处理后的视频数据上传到HDFS。
(2)数据写入:使用Hudi客户端将视频数据写入Hudi表。
(3)数据更新:当视频数据发生变化时,使用Hudi客户端进行更新。
图片来源于网络,如有侵权联系删除
(4)数据查询:使用Hudi客户端查询视频数据。
Hudi数据湖存储视频的优势
1、高性能:Hudi数据湖存储方案支持并行读写,能够有效提高视频数据存储和检索性能。
2、高可用性:Hudi数据湖存储方案采用分布式存储架构,确保视频数据的高可用性。
3、可扩展性:Hudi数据湖存储方案支持水平扩展,能够满足不断增长的视频数据存储需求。
4、灵活性:Hudi数据湖存储方案支持多种数据模型,能够满足不同场景下的视频数据管理需求。
5、易用性:Hudi数据湖存储方案提供丰富的API和工具,方便用户进行视频数据管理。
Hudi数据湖存储方案为视频数据管理提供了高效、稳定、便捷的解决方案,通过Hudi数据湖存储视频,用户可以轻松实现视频数据的存储、管理和检索,随着大数据技术的不断发展,Hudi数据湖存储方案将在视频数据管理领域发挥越来越重要的作用。
标签: #hudi数据湖怎么存视频
评论列表